*At Ndejje University, Bombo

Eight schools are set to compete in 2024 Fresh Dairy Girls football 2024 championship at Ndejje University playground in Bombo on Tuesday, 18th June.

Holders Amus College School, 2023 runners up St Noa Girls Secondary School, Sacred Hearts S.S, Uganda Martyrs High School, Kawempe Muslim Secondary School, Rines Secondary School, Sheema Girls School and Boni Concil Girls Vocational school will compete in the continued version of the tournament.

In May 2024, this tournament was halted at the quarter final stage to allow thorough preparations for the national U-16 national team that played against Zambia during the continental qualifiers.

Match ups:

The opening match on the day will be Amus College School against Sacred Hearts SS – Gulu at 9:00 AM.

This will be followed by Uganda Martyrs High School against Kawempe Muslim Secondary School (11:00 AM).

At 2:00 PM, the contest will be between Rines Secondary School and Sheema Girls School before the final duel between Boni Concil Girls Vocational and St Noa Girls Secondary School at 4:00 PM.

The successful four schools will lock-horns in the semi-finals the subsequent day and the final on 21st June 2024.

Four schools will represent Uganda at the forthcoming 2024 FEASSSA Games to be co-hosted by Amus College and Bukedea Comprehensive.

Defending champions Kawempe Muslim SS are already guaranteed of a slot in the 2024 FEASSSA Games alongside the hosts Amus College and Bukedea Comprehensive.
